First Sunday in LentFebruary 26, 2012 Genesis 9:8-17 Psalm 25:1-10 (10) 1 Peter 3:18-22 Mark 1:9-15 Prayer of the Day Holy God, heavenly Father, in the waters of the flood you saved the chosen, and in the wilderness of temptation you protected your Son from sin. Renew us in the gift of baptism. May your holy angels be with us, that the wicked foe may have no power over us, through Jesus Christ, our Savior and Lord, who lives and reigns with you and the Holy Spirit, one God, now and forever. Gospel Acclamation One does not live by | bread alone, but by every word that comes from the | mouth of God. (Matt. 4:4) Color: Purple |
Second Sunday in LentMarch 4, 2012Genesis 17:1-7, 15-16 Psalm 22:23-31 (27) Romans 4:13-25 Mark 8:31-38 Prayer of the Day O God, by the passion of your blessed Son you made an instrument of shameful death to be for us the means of life. Grant us so to glory in the cross of Christ that we may gladly suffer shame and loss for the sake of your Son, Jesus Christ our Savior and Lord, who lives and reigns with you and the Holy Spirit, one God, now and forever. Gospel Acclamation May I never boast of anything except the cross of our Lord | Jesus Christ, by which the world is crucified to me, and I | to the world. (Gal. 6:14) Color: Purple |
Third Sunday in LentMarch 11, 2012Exodus 20:1-17 Psalm 19 (8) I Corinthians 1:18-25 John 2:13-22 Prayer of the Day Holy God, through your Son you have called us to live faithfully and act courageously. Keep us steadfast in your covenant of grace, and teach us the wisdom that comes only through Jesus Christ, our Savior and Lord, who lives and reigns with you and the Holy Spirit, one God, now and forever. Gospel Acclamation We proclaim Christ | crucified, the power of God and the wis- | dom of God. (1 Cor. 1:23, 24) Color: Purple |

Fourth Sunday in LentMarch 18, 2012Numbers 21:4-9 Psalm 107:1-3, 17-22 (19) Ephesians 2:1-10 John 3:14-21 Prayer of the Day O God, rich in mercy, by the humiliation of your Son you lifted up this fallen world and rescued us from the hopelessness of death. Lead us into your light, that all our deeds may reflect your love, through Jesus Christ, our Savior and Lord, who lives and reigns with you and the Holy Spirit, one God, now and forever. Gospel Acclamation God so loved the world that he gave his | only Son, so that everyone who believes in him should not perish, but have e- | ternal life. (John 3:16) Color: Purple |
